(3 May 1972) STORY
A summit meeting is to be held in New Delhi in May or June 1972, attended by President Bhutto, Indian Premier Mrs. Gandhi, and the Bengali leader Sheikh Mujib. The three leaders are expected to arrive at a peace formula which will lead to the resumption of diplomatic and trade relations between India and Pakistan, the recognition of Bengla Desh by Pakistan, and significant changes in the Kashmir ceasefire line in India's favour. In this report, we interview President Bhutto about the issues at stake in the talks, and on the security of his own position in Pakistan. We also interview Abdul Wali Khan, the leader of the NationalAwami Party, who is leading a provincial indepen dence movement that could lead to yet another fragmentation of Pakistan.
